CleanGSR Posted March 3, 2007 Share Posted March 3, 2007 You won't be able to get full coilovers for that price (not decent one's at least). You could get Tokico Illumina's 5 way adjustable shocks and ground control coilovers for around $700. Well, that's what it was for my car, I'd assume around the same price for yours.
